Output d5da25c602da215ac6774ec6b51ee4bd7b6f51666295140e5e425dbb2673a90d:52

value
621280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f67e710fb6efaa3f4185de69e86a9599e8c68c5 OP_EQUAL
address
3DJgDBihom5fMU2x34jmzrnr6vtEHvGjFU
transaction
d5da25c602da215ac6774ec6b51ee4bd7b6f51666295140e5e425dbb2673a90d
spent
true